Android智能手機的應用性能檢測研究
發(fā)布時間:2017-06-09 12:18
本文關鍵詞:Android智能手機的應用性能檢測研究,由筆耕文化傳播整理發(fā)布。
【摘要】:目前,市場上涌現(xiàn)了各種各樣的移動應用程序(app),但程序管理類的應用程序卻很少見。許多應用程序對于手機電量的使用效率不高,甚至有些應用程序花費大量的電量來運行一些對用戶本身無關的進程。同時,惡意應用軟件的數(shù)量與日俱增。這些惡意軟件往往造成手機能量的大量消耗,縮短手機使用生命周期,并且能在用戶不知情的情況下惡意獲取一些私人信息。為解決這類問題,需要提供應用程序在用戶手機內運行的詳細信息,也需要從應用程序的相應評價機制來作出判斷,從而協(xié)助用戶有效地管理應用程序。本文結合模糊聚類算法,提出了一種用于Android系統(tǒng)應用程序的能耗異常檢測方法。并設計了一款面向Android系統(tǒng)的應用管理程序,能檢測出Android系統(tǒng)中應用的能量、函數(shù)調用和行為使用異常情況。整個系統(tǒng)分為智能手機端和終端兩部分。在智能手機端,該系統(tǒng)能對智能手機所運行的應用程序進行一些基本操作,并收集所有應用的使用信息,發(fā)送給終端進行數(shù)據(jù)處理,得到各程序性能情況信息。在終端,該系統(tǒng)將先利用用戶所傳送的應用使用情況信息,通過本文所設計的能耗計算方法和模糊C-均值聚類算法獲得各應用能耗信息,并對其能耗數(shù)據(jù)進行評級處理。利用所得的應用能耗信息和其他從用戶智能手機端發(fā)送的各應用內存占有量、CPU使用率、Intent使用情況和Permission調用情況等信息,在終端利用AbnDroid算法對用戶所使用的應用進行綜合分析,從而了解各程序的活動情況,對各應用的性能做出評價。實驗表明,該方法可對智能手機各應用程序的性能情況做出有效判斷,有利于用戶智能設備的穩(wěn)定運行。
【關鍵詞】:安卓 模糊C均值算法 異常檢測 應用程序 性能 能量
【學位授予單位】:中南林業(yè)科技大學
【學位級別】:碩士
【學位授予年份】:2015
【分類號】:TP316;TN929.53
【目錄】:
- 摘要4-5
- ABSTRACT5-8
- 1 緒論8-18
- 1.1 研究背景8-9
- 1.2 異常檢測研究現(xiàn)狀9-15
- 1.2.1 基于電池能耗信息的異常檢測10-11
- 1.2.2 基于網(wǎng)絡信息流量的異常檢測11-12
- 1.2.3 基于應用行為的異常檢測12
- 1.2.4 基于函數(shù)調用情況的異常檢測12-15
- 1.2.4.1 意圖攻擊14
- 1.2.4.2 權限許可攻擊14
- 1.2.4.3 WebViews攻擊14-15
- 1.3 智能手機應用檢測研究現(xiàn)狀15-16
- 1.4 研究意義16-17
- 1.5 本論文的主要研究工作17-18
- 2 應用性能檢測系統(tǒng)設計方法18-27
- 2.1 應用能耗檢測方法19-24
- 2.1.1 應用能耗檢測方法設計原理20
- 2.1.2 應用能耗檢測方法優(yōu)化20-23
- 2.1.3 應用能耗異常的判定23-24
- 2.2 應用函數(shù)調用檢測方法24
- 2.2.1 應用函數(shù)調用檢測方法設計原理24
- 2.3 應用行為檢測方法24-25
- 2.3.1 應用行為檢測方法設計原理25
- 2.4 本章小結25-27
- 3 應用能耗檢測系統(tǒng)設計27-37
- 3.1 系統(tǒng)框架設計27-32
- 3.1.1 手機進程控制27-28
- 3.1.2 運行應用列表28-30
- 3.1.3 應用能耗信息收集30-32
- 3.2 模糊聚類分析設計32-35
- 3.3 本章小結35-37
- 4 AbnDroid應用異常檢測系統(tǒng)設計37-44
- 4.1 ComDroid設計原理37
- 4.2 AbnDroid設計分析37-42
- 4.2.1 文件分析38
- 4.2.2 X-Eprof38-42
- 4.2.2.1 相關應用異常檢測方法38-41
- 4.2.2.2 X-Eprof應用行為檢測方法設計41-42
- 4.3 本章小結42-44
- 5 系統(tǒng)測試與評價44-51
- 5.1 運行程序使用測試44-46
- 5.2 智能手機應用能耗模糊聚類分析測試46-48
- 5.3 應用性能檢測測試48-49
- 5.4 本章小結49-51
- 6 總結51-54
- 參考文獻54-62
- 攻讀學位期間的主要學術成果62-64
- 致謝64
【參考文獻】
中國期刊全文數(shù)據(jù)庫 前2條
1 孫其博;;手機病毒與移動通信安全[J];電信網(wǎng)技術;2008年07期
2 楊杰;;基于Linux的強制訪問控制研究[J];電腦與電信;2008年11期
本文關鍵詞:Android智能手機的應用性能檢測研究,,由筆耕文化傳播整理發(fā)布。
本文編號:435451
本文鏈接:http://sikaile.net/kejilunwen/wltx/435451.html
最近更新
教材專著